The AER Annual Conference 2023 marked a new beginning after two years of planning under pandemic conditions. Held in Amsterdam, this event for the Alliance of Independent Travel Agencies (AER) brought together 500 travel agencies and 400 specialized tour operators, with a large portion focused on sustainable travel. U.S. Travel Association has designated April 3 as Global Meetings Industry Day, an annual international event celebrating the major impact meetings, conferences, trade shows and exhibitions have on people, businesses and communities. Global Meetings Industry Day, or GMID as most call it, has roots that go back more than two decades in Canada. It started as National Meetings Industry Day, thanks to the passion and dedication of the Canadian MPI chapters.

Recent announcements about career changes include: Mara Craft Mara Craft has been promoted to General Manager of the Raleigh Convention Center and Red Hat Amphitheater. Craft has worked at the Raleigh Convention Center for 27 years, starting as an assistant to most recently serving as Director of Sales and Marketing. She is an active member of the IAVM and serves on various committees for PCMA.
